DENVER, CO, October 03, 2012 (Press-News.org) Eric Kimberling, president of Panorama Consulting Solutions, will share his SAP expertise at Managing Your SAP Projects 2012, the premier event for professionals that use, evaluate, deploy and support SAP functionality for SAP and SAP BusinessObjects projects. Kimberling will present Best Practices for Achieving End-user Adoption Through Efficient SAP Training and Communication on the second day of the conference (October 30).
"The success of a SAP initiative hinges on the willingness and ability of an organization's staff to adopt - and adapt to - the system," said Kimberling. "System training, employee and executive communication and other change management activities are critical to ensuring SAP software delivers all of the business benefits it is capable of enabling in a timely and measurable manner."
At Managing Your SAP Projects 2012, attendees will learn how to enhance the planning and management of SAP and SAP BusinessObjects projects. They'll meet with and listen to top SAP experts, leading independent consultants and innovative partner organizations to get answers to all their questions about SAP. Speakers will uncover latest strategies and tips for ASAP methodology, budgeting, change management, data migration, outsourcing, risk management, system consolidations and upgrades.
Managing Your SAP Projects 2012 takes place October 29-31 at the Mandalay Bay Resort and Casino in Las Vegas. To find out more about this event, and to register, please visit http://www.sapprojects2012.com.
